Harrisburg Purse Heads Tonights Cahokia Card: Andy-Mandy Probable Favorite Over Six Opponents in Sprint, Daily Racing Form, 1957-05-01

Hcrrrisburg Purse Heads Tonights Cahokia Card CardAndyMandy AndyMandy Probable Favorite Over Six Opponents in Sprint SprintBy By J J HAHN HAHNCAHOKIA CAHOKIA DOWNS East St Louis 111 April 30 The Initial midweek program of the southern Illinois season is down for de ¬ cision Wednesday night and featuring the menu is the Harrisburg Purse a six and onehalf furlongs dash for threeyearolds There are seven named including an entry and expected to go postward as the public choice is Edward Kudlas AndyMandy an invader from Hialeah The son of Persian Gulf Booklet noted for his route running meets formidable rivals in the Frank o Akin coupling of Flashy Fellow and Big Coupon Martin F Keelys Jimmie Yancey Morrows Stella Way and Abbess Quest from the Otis Fulton and Mrs Charles Nagle unit unitAndyMandy AndyMandy comes highly rated having raced in good company during the Florida season and he will have the services of Continued on Page Forty Thru Harrisburg Purse Heads Tonights Cahokia Card CardAndyMandy AndyMandy Probable Favorite Over Six Opponents in Sprint SprintContinued Continued from Page FortyFour FortyFourHarrell Harrell Bolin the youngster who won the initial race of his career in this area last year and proved a sensation this past spring in Florida Bolin will be remembered as riding five winners on one program at Sunshine Park and came off with top honors among the reinsmen there then moved over to Gulf stream where he also held the reins on five winners on a single card cardMost Most of the competition is expected to come from Flashy Fellow who campaigned during the Oaklawn Park meeting This fine looking son of Flash O Night raced he e last fall and was heralded as a fine prospect in his sophomore year but the colt was injured before the running of a race here in one of his early starts and never came up to expectations in the re ¬ mainder of the season However he has been training well and could spring a sur ¬ prise in downing the likely favorite Flashy Fellow will have a lot of help from the speedy Big Coupon who like his stable mate was also given a careful prep at Hot Springs SpringsJimmie Jimmie Yancey won a race during the Sunshine Park meeting and trainer John Merchut has had him in steady training since his arrival here G Lad will be re membered as one of the best soft performing twoyearolds racin fall while Stella Way wo race at Oaklawn Park must be given serious consideration Abbess Quest did not get to the races as a juvenile and is still a non winner winnerThere There is a fine supporting card includ ¬ ing the fifth Jmd sixth races a race that was divided by racing secretary Hender ¬ son Van Zandt It brings together horses of the 2500 claiming class and includes many runners well known to local fans fansAlso Also programmed is a twoyearold race to be used as the third A field of nine makes up this maiden affair and is to be staged over the four furlongs distance distanceProspects Prospects are for a fast track Wednes ¬ day night The sun made an appearance yesterday afternoon after 15 straight days of rain and todays bright sunshine im ¬ proved the course so rapidly it was expect ¬ ed to be fast Post time is 830 CDT
